One of the first questions any business asks before commissioning a software project is: how much is this actually going to cost? In Saudi Arabia, the answer varies widely — and understanding why is just as important as knowing the numbers.
This guide breaks down the real cost of custom software development in KSA in 2026 — by project tier, by the factors that drive pricing, and by the hidden costs most vendors won't mention upfront.
Custom software development in Saudi Arabia typically ranges from SAR 15,000 (~$4,000) for simple applications to SAR 500,000+ (~$130,000+) for enterprise-grade platforms and AI-powered systems.
Cost Overview at a Glance
Every software project in KSA falls into one of three broad tiers based on scope, complexity, and scale. Here's how they break down:
Basic
Simple Applications & Tools
SAR 15,000 – 50,000
Landing pages, internal productivity tools, basic mobile apps with limited screens, simple booking or appointment systems.
Medium
Business Systems & Mobile Apps
SAR 50,000 – 200,000
Business management systems, multi-feature mobile apps for iOS & Android, customer portals, e-commerce platforms, CRM solutions.
Advanced
Enterprise Platforms & AI Solutions
SAR 200,000+
AI-powered platforms, custom ERP systems, multi-tenant SaaS products, complex enterprise integrations, blockchain and cloud-native infrastructure.
Basic Applications: SAR 15,000 – 50,000
This tier suits startups, small businesses, and companies that need a focused digital tool without extensive complexity. Projects here typically include:
- Marketing landing pages with contact forms and basic CMS
- Mobile apps with 5–15 screens and straightforward functionality
- Simple dashboards displaying data from an existing source
- Basic booking, appointment, or reservation tools
- Small e-commerce stores with a limited product catalogue
Timeline for basic projects is typically 4 to 10 weeks, delivered by a lean team of 2–3 developers. The risk of scope creep is lowest here — as long as requirements are locked before development begins.
Medium-Complexity Projects: SAR 50,000 – 200,000
The most common tier in the Saudi market. These projects demand polished UI/UX design, integrations with external APIs or payment gateways, and cloud infrastructure. Examples include:
- iOS and Android apps with a backend admin panel
- HR management, inventory, or operations systems
- Multi-vendor e-commerce platforms
- Customer or government service portals
- Custom CRM systems tailored to specific sales workflows

Advanced & Enterprise Solutions: SAR 200,000+
Enterprise-level projects start at SAR 200,000 and can reach into the millions for large-scale national systems. These demand senior engineering teams, rigorous security compliance, and extended timelines. They typically include:
- AI and machine learning platforms with Arabic NLP
- Fully custom ERP systems replacing off-the-shelf solutions
- Multi-tenant SaaS products with subscription billing
- Large-scale logistics and delivery platforms
- Blockchain integrations and smart contract development

Key Factors That Affect Cost
Price isn't arbitrary — five core factors determine where your project lands on the cost spectrum:
Project Complexity & Features
More screens, workflows, roles, and integrations means more hours — and more cost. Every feature added after kickoff compounds this.
UI/UX Design Requirements
Custom design adds 15–30% to the project cost but significantly improves user retention and conversion rates.
Technology Stack
AI, cloud-native architectures, and real-time systems require more specialized skills and infrastructure, raising both time and budget.
Team Size & Experience
Senior Saudi developers command higher rates, but the quality gap between senior and junior talent is substantial in complex projects.
Security & Compliance
PDPL compliance, cybersecurity requirements, and NCA (National Cybersecurity Authority) standards add necessary cost for sensitive projects.
Maintenance & Support
Plan for 15–20% of the initial development cost annually for ongoing maintenance, updates, and support contracts.
Hidden Costs to Watch For
Most vendors quote you a build cost — but that's rarely the full picture. These are the costs that catch businesses off guard:
⚠️ Heads up: Hidden costs can add 20–40% to your total spend if not identified and budgeted for at the start of the project.
- Cloud hosting fees: AWS, Azure, or STC Cloud can run SAR 1,000–20,000/month depending on traffic and data volume
- Third-party tool licences: Some libraries and SaaS tools used in your build carry recurring annual fees
- QA and security testing: Proper testing can represent 15–20% of development cost — skipping it is riskier and costlier long-term
- Staff training and documentation: Getting your team fluent in the new system is often overlooked in budgets
- Mid-project scope changes: Every feature added after kickoff resets timelines and adds cost
- Payment gateway integration: Hyperpay, Mada, and other local gateways carry both technical integration and commercial setup costs
How to Choose the Right Development Partner in KSA
The vendor you choose matters as much as the budget you set. Here's what separates reliable software partners from risky ones in the Saudi market:
- A clear portfolio of completed projects in your industry vertical
- A local team that understands Saudi regulations, culture, and Arabic UX
- Full transparency in pricing with fixed-scope or milestone-based contracts
- An Agile delivery model with regular reviews and deliverables
- A post-launch support plan — not just a handoff
- Proven experience with PDPL compliance and cybersecurity best practices
